WE HAD a hard-fought game against Herefordshire in our latest Unicorns Championship match but the lads fought really well over the three days and we are thrilled with the win.

They ought to be proud of the performance they put in. It was a really good result, although it went right down to the wire.

It probably has happened before but I can’t remember a game where we had three separate centurions.

There were a couple of really good knocks in there and the crucial ones were in the first innings.

We bleat on about trying to get first-innings runs and first-innings points and we did that.

We had been 135-5, so we were up against it a little bit, but Michael Coles’ innings and the one from Patrick Greishaber were both tremendous.

It was over a 200-run partnership, which was a record for that wicket, and that set us up for the victory.

Michael set the tone for us on the first day but it wasn’t really a typical Michael Coles knock. He tends to get in and puts bat to ball and likes to impose himself on the bowlers.

It was a more controlled innings in line of the position that we found ourselves in and he was supported extremely well by Patrick, who also contributed superbly.

It was a great effort and setting 392 in the first innings and getting all the bonus points was great.

Even they picked up all their bonus points but they still found themselves 60 runs behind and that was crucial come the end of the game.

We found ourselves in a little bit of strife overnight on the second day and Neil Clark had to bat extremely well to get us out of a little bit of a hole.

We managed to get out and set them around about what we wanted to set them - 325 to 330.

Tahir Afridi bowled a mammoth spell on the final day to seal the win. He bowled some left arm seam and left-arm spin. He just showed the talent he has.
